ISOhub is strong if you need an all-in-one back office today: residual reporting and multi-level commissions from any processor, e-signature with auto-populated merchant agreements, a boarding module, agent/partner portals, and ticketing. If those are your bottleneck, ISOhub covers them — you'll just need to request a quote and there's no public trial.
